The Problem: Glass + Sun = Heat Gain
Glass is beloved for design — but ordinary glass lets in more than light:
- It allows infrared (IR) and ultraviolet (UV) radiation, both of which carry heat and can damage interiors.
- In hot and sunny climates like Dubai, that means interiors turn uncomfortably warm very fast.
- Conventional solutions — thick curtains, dark tints, or blinds — solve the heat problem but at the cost of light, view, and aesthetics.

Backed by Science: Why Nanotech Glass Coatings Work
Recent advances in nanotechnology and glass-coating science show that coatings targeting near-infrared (NIR) and infrared (IR) wavelengths can dramatically improve a building’s thermal performance — without sacrificing visible light transparency.
Traditional “low-emissivity” (low-E) coatings, already widely used for energy-efficient buildings, also work on similar principles: they minimize radiative heat transfer and block infrared radiation while allowing daylight.
But nanotech coatings — like HeatCure Nanotech ’s — go a step further, offering retrofit-friendly solutions that work even on existing windows, and with higher spectral selectivity (i.e better IR + UV rejection, minimal visible light loss).
